1. Technician Performance Dashboard – Data View
The Data View displays performance details for each crew or technician in a structured table. The dashboard is organized to help supervisors quickly assess workload, job completion, and resource utilization.
1.1 Main Table Structure
For each technician group (crew), the table shows the following columns:
Name: The name of the crew or technician.
Type: Indicates whether the record represents a Crew or an individual User.
Completed Jobs: Number of jobs fully completed by the crew/technician.
Assigned Jobs: Total jobs allocated for the crew/technician within the selected date range.
Completion Rate: The percentage of assigned jobs that have been completed (e.g., 12.1%, 6.1%, etc.), visually indicated by a progress bar.
Avg Jobs Per Period: The average number of jobs completed per reporting period (such as per week or month). Shows workload trends over time.
Avg Completion Time: Average duration (in hours) required to complete a job. Useful for benchmarking speed and efficiency.
Utilization Rate: Indicates the percentage of the technician’s capacity that is actively used (e.g., 85%). This is visually displayed as a blue progress bar for easy comparison.
This detailed view enables efficient identification of high-performing groups and quick detection of productivity gaps.

1.1 KPI Boxes (Summary Metrics)
At the top of the dashboard, you’ll find key performance indicators for the selected timeframe:
Total Jobs: Total number of jobs assigned to technicians
Average Completion Rate: The percentage of assigned jobs completed
Average Utilization: The proportion of available technician time spent on productive work
These values provide a high-level snapshot of operational performance for your team.
1.2 Visualization
Below the KPI boxes are interactive visual graphs and tables that provide deeper insight into technician and team activity:
Completion Rate by Group: Compares the job completion ratios across different technician groups or teams, highlighting areas of high and low performance. This visualization helps identify which groups are effectively completing assigned work and which may need additional support or resources.
Productivity Metrics: Graphs key measures such as average job completion time and total jobs per technician, allowing you to benchmark technical efficiency.
Utilization by Group: Displays how effectively different technician teams utilize their available working hours, helping optimize resource allocation.
Productivity Trends: Visualizes trends in completion rate and utilization over time, offering an at-a-glance view of workforce improvements or emerging issues.
Each visualization can be filtered or refined for different job categories, technician groups, users, or custom date ranges.
3. Interpreting Technician Metrics
Total Jobs: Reflects workload and assignment rate for the selected period.
Average Completion Rate: A higher rate indicates strong execution and reliability across teams.
Average Utilization: Shows how fully technicians’ available time is used; low utilization may signal under-scheduling or inefficiency.
Productivity Metrics: Include average completion time per job and jobs closed per technician.
Completion Rate by Group / Utilization by Group: Identifies which groups excel or may need improvement, guiding workforce development efforts.
Trends: Longitudinal data helps spot improvement, decline, or seasonal shifts in technician performance.
